Former Real Madrid striker Raul Gonzalez on Tuesday reached an agreement to play for New York Cosmos, beginning in January 2015. According to AS, the 37-year-old will travel to theUnited States this week to sign a new contract, which will commit him to the club for at least the next two seasons.
